Just saw the results of the first superbike race from the North West 200 in Northern Ireland. Michael Rutter won on a CBR-RR at an average speed of 122 mph (200km/hr) and clocked 194 mph (320km/hr) :shock: through the speed trap. All this on ordinary roads, most on 2 lane country roads. You gotta see it to believe it. Brilliant!!! :D The NW is seen as the prelim to the TT for the riders, gets the apropriate juices flowing :twisted: . The most fancied Kwaka rider, Ryan FARQUHAR, pulled out on lap 4 ..... pity as he is good value and keeps the Kwaka fkag flying :cry: .

Second race was declared wet. Average race speed was 112 mph (about 185 km/hr). Didn't see the speed through the trap but it would be close to the 1st race. NZ Bruce Anstey won on a Suzi. I've seen him on some DVDs and he is one of the smoothest riders in road racing.

Hi guys i,m in singapore airport on my way back from NW 200 it was unreal, this is my home race just 35 miles from my home town, just moved to oz 2 years ago, I was chatting to Bruce and his team mate adrain the day they got there new gxser 1000 there were setting them up at a little circuit beside my wife,s parents they are great blokes and very down to earth Bruce did well to win the last race he had only ridden the bike for the first time a week earlier,

Ryan won his race on the 05 zx6r he was racing for friends of mine MC adoo team before moving this year a very good smooth rider and Kawasaki mad,

If any of you ever get the chance get over there for the NW 200 its not to be missed this is real racing not for the fant hearted, Rutter was clocked at 201 mph last year and only the wet weather stopped the bikes betting that record this year,
